Jim Carrey: Factory Cleaner

When it comes to comedy films and shows, perhaps Jim Carrey carries the day. The Canadian-American actor-comedian has delivered spellbinding and rib-cracking performances in “The Mask,” “Bruce Almighty,” and many more. Those who’ve become accustomed to his witty character may not believe it when they’re told about his first job.

The “30 Rock” actor started working as a 16-year-old, post-dropping out of school, as a janitor in a factory. Probably being his funny self at work, Carrey’s factory cleaning job didn’t last long, as he was discovered one year in and became the opening act for Rodney Dangerfield and Buddy Hackett.
